Texas Lt. Governor and Senate candidate David Dewhurst, now down five points against Ted Cruz in a new poll, has been called out on some additional “dewbious” activities.

Mark Levin’s tweet links to a report that Dewhurst scrubbed the transcript of a speech that advocated amnesty from the official website for the office of the Lieutenant Governor of Texas. The link to the speech is now dead, while Cruz’s campaign website hosts a handy PDF.
Some are calling it “#404gate.”
